This great rocker, recorded in May 1959, rose to the #5 spot on the Billboard Top 40 chart. It was the flipside of "Frankie," another huge million-selling hit for Connie. This was a double-sided hit - the first for a female recording artist of the rock-and-roll era. I worked with old video but laid down an audio track using the CD version of the song.   • The "IFIC" buttons were given to the audience (along with free sticks of Beech-Nut gum) to wear during the show, to remind viewers of the sponsor's slogan, "Beech-Nut Flavor-IFIC Gum".
